Operations Associate
On-site · Charleston, South Carolina, United States or Nashville, Tennessee, United States
Job Summary
Operations Associate supports the Director of Operations and is responsible for all aspects of business operations management within property management. Responsibilities include supporting on-site leasing teams with leasing system tech support and one-off requests, acting as an alternate main point of home office contact for leasing operations, drafting communications, administering and updating leasing operations systems, supporting leadership with operational training initiatives for site teams, researching and preparing presentations for new initiatives, reviewing and distributing SOP documentation, scheduling team-wide meetings and training, collaborating with IT/Marketing/Finance/HR/Legal & Development on cross-functional projects, updating portfolio-wide electronic documents, working with outside vendors on leasing-focused accounts and projects, and completing other tasks as directed. Key skills include str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, time management, ability to learn new technologies, and proficiency with MS Word, MS Excel, MS PowerPoint, and Google Suites. Education preferred but not required beyond HS, with a path toward a Bachelor’s degree preferred; the role emphasizes property management experience and cross-functional collaboration.
